Output 59083f0e77eaeeb6d282f180232285d6861c92e0d48dcf86dc54ed24af22abb6:0

value
14200
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 73ec602773a0a3523748393dfdcb21bbd5c5654b7436176c694c645793e6fe0f
address
ltc1pw0kxqfmn5z34yd6g8y7lmjeph02u2e2twsmpwmrff3j90ylxlc8s5664qw
transaction
59083f0e77eaeeb6d282f180232285d6861c92e0d48dcf86dc54ed24af22abb6
spent
true